Staff at Mines of Spain State Recreation Area ask for volunteer help this week to clean several areas recently vandalized with spray paint.

In a Facebook post Sunday, staff said they plan to start cleaning spray-painted rocks and trees around Horseshoe Bluff. Staff purchased cleaning supplies, including wire brushes, chisels and paint remover, to provide for volunteers.

Park Ranger Wayne Buccholtz said cleaning will be done from 1 to 4 p.m. May 4th and again on Friday May 8th, starting at 9 a.m. He said how long the cleaning efforts will take will depend on the weather and the volunteer turnout.

Volunteers can call the park office at 563-556-0620 for updated times and locations of cleaning crews.

Buchholtz said staff still are investigating who is responsible for the graffiti and have a list of suspects. He asked anyone with information to contact the park office.
